Tamil Nadu engineering admissions officials warned that a scheduling clash with the NEET-UG retest could delay counselling for more than 300,000 diploma and degree aspirants.
The Directorate of Technical Education said verification and rank publication depend on finalized medical entrance dates that remain unsettled nationally.
Students who must sit for both processes face overlapping travel and document-submission windows, prompting colleges to request a staggered calendar.
Parent associations petitioned the state government to secure a Union Education Ministry waiver or adjusted NEET slot for southern candidates.
Until coordination improves, institutions may postpone seat allotment meetings, extending uncertainty for families already navigating fee hikes and hostel shortages.
